Renew Your Mind

I read an interesting - and challenging - article in this month's issue of Charisma entitled "Go Against the Flow" by Rich Rogers. The article addresses the challenge of "staying faithful to God when the people around you are compromising." A study was conducted on 10,000 individuals from around the nation and found "that most people who claim to be a Christian don't have the mind of God on important issues." According to the results, 84% claimed to be Christian and some of the "same people also deemed the following behaviors and lifestyles 'morally acceptable':"

  • Abortion - 45%
  • Adultery - 42%
  • Cohabitation - 60%
  • Gambling - 61%
  • Pornography - 38%
  • Sexual relations between homosexuals - 30%
  • Use of profanity - 36%

Rogers notes, "The Bible tells us that man will never think the thoughts of God unless he experiences the transformation of the mind" and references Isaiah 55:8-9.

"So, how does one begin the transformation process? Simply put, you must learn what God has to say about everything. How? Become familiar with His Word and allow it to change the way you think."
